Quote:
Originally Posted by bilt4mud
Thanks for the comments, good to know that they are identical shafts to the XJ's. So the outers also the same too I guess?... meaning they fit without any mods to the hubs?

btw, how much lift are you running with your 32's?

Cheers

bilt4mud
Yep no mods to the hubs at all, everything fits perfectly. It's only the ABS you may need to sort out depending on what you get.

Running true 32's, I have a 4.5" lift extended bump stops and steering stops. No trimming as I have an ARB bar, just needed to fold over the seams on the inside of the front wheel wells.

The rears only just fit (10mm clearance) in the well when fully stuffed, they do rub on the top of the spring though.
